Frers design combines with Swedish build quality for a bluewater yacht with seriously refined performance, volume and layout. The dream? asks Toby Hodges, sailing the first Hallberg-Rassy 50

But it isn't particularly designed for 'blue water' I would at least expect some sea berths that would allow sleeping on either tack and provision for lee boards or cloths. On long ocean reaches they are more or less essential. A double berth should also have a split mattress to allow a centre cloth or board, again to allow comfortable sleeping on either tack. A handy pilot berth near the companion to the cockpit is an essential too. Similarly with seating and tables, you need to be able to sit and eat comfortably on either tack. Without this a yacht is just a weekender no matter how well it sails.

Neither's opinion would really be worth all that much...... Just differing opinions. It's the quality of their workforces and processes which matter. Once dealing with cruising yachts, where not every single gram of weight counts against you, it's quality of execution which determines how well similarly shaped keels and rudders are affixed to the hull. Not headline "design philosophy" Just as is the case wrt hull material. Both the HR and Kraken ways can be made rock solid, or flimsy and unsuitable, for cruising appropriate moderate aspect keels and rudders.

I absolutely love the brand, but I think that my definition of bluewater yacht is different. To begin with I would like to see some significant cockpit protection for foul weather -- that small dodger isn't going to cut it for major squalls. With a boat of this size the dinghy davit system is a must -- I don't want to have to manhandle the dinghy or the motor off of the fore deck (I didn't notice anywhere to even mount an outboard -- saillocker? That sounds like fun -- not!!!). With a draft of close to 8 feet it's not designed for sailing to many favorable destinations (Caribbean, French Polynesia, Seychelles, etc) where people sail to experience the beauty of the reefs. Finally, spending over 100,000 € for the mast, boom, spreader, and sail system just doesn't sit well with me -- just imagine needing to find parts for a 100,000 € set of standing rigging in a remote anchorage in French Polynesia --- welcome to your new home for the next few months!!! Lastly, I did love the engine room with both front and rear access to the engine, but I wonder about the access to the sides of the engine -- with all of the beam that they were so proud of mentioning, I can't help but think that an extra 3" per side might just make the difference between an easy repair and a difficult repair out at sea.
